New Belgian citizens in 2024

4,048 new Belgian citizens in August 2024: how migration policy affects the country

In August 2024, Belgium granted citizenship to 4,048 foreigners, indicating a steady increase in the number of new citizens. This data, provided by the country’s statistical service, highlights the importance of migration policy and the process of obtaining citizenship in the country. Belgium's refugee reception in 2024

Belgium’s refugee reception system: new records and unsolved challenges

Belgium’s reception network has reached a historic capacity of 36,077 places, surpassing the figures from the 2015-2016 crisis. However, despite this progress, the problem of a shortage of places for applicants for international protection remains acute, especially for single men.
